KING, Judge.

For the reasons assigned in Grappe v. State of Louisiana, Dept. of Transportation and Development, 462 So.2d 1343 (La.App. 3rd Cir.1985), the judgment of trial court is affirmed. The costs of this appeal are to be paid by defendant-appellant.

AFFIRMED.

STOKER, J. concurs and assigns written reasons.

DOMENGEAUX, J., concurs in the result.
